One tea that is not from China this time is Rooibos. Originating from South Africa, the leaves for rooibos tea are picked and undergo a fermentation process, giving them the recognisable red colour you are used to. A nice benefit of rooibos tea is that it contains a substance that inhibits inflammation. Furthermore, rooibos tea can boost your heart health. In short, a tea full of goodness. Try it now!

How to make loose rooibos tea?

Brewing rooibos tea requires attention to detail to reveal the full opulence of flavours. Start by heating fresh water to just below boiling, then add the loose rooibos leaves to a tea filter or tea strainer. Let the tea steep gently for about 5 to 7 minutes, depending on the desired strength. The slow process of infusion gives the rooibos time to develop its characteristic red hue and deep flavour. For an extra touch of finesse, you can combine the tea with other ingredients such as vanilla, orange or spices, creating a unique blend. The result is a delicious cup of rooibos tea.
